TimeJumpはJavaScript製、MIT License/GPLのオープンソース・ソフトウェアです。

Podcastingというと、単純なMP3ファイルの配信であるため最初から最後まで全体を聞かないといけないイメージがあります。しかしTimeJumpを使えば指定時間からの再生が簡単に実現できます。

[![](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.11_thumb.1374493981.png)](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.11.1374493981.png)
表示例。audioタグに対してTimeJumpが適用されています。そして下のリンクに時間指定が埋め込まれています。

[![](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.22_thumb.1374493984.png)](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.22.1374493984.png)
こんな感じに#t=で開始時間を指定できます。

[![](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.52_thumb.1374493986.png)](http://images.moongift.jp/2013/07/Screenshot 2013-07-22 9.23.52.1374493986.png)
埋め込み例。アンカーの他、クエリーが使えます。時間の表示もYouTubeライクな指定に対応しています。

TimeJumpを使えば気になったトピックがあった時に、その埋め込みでの紹介がとても簡単になります。また、一連のPodcastingの中でテーマを分けている場合にその頭出しとして使うとユーザにとっては便利でしょう。

MOONGIFTはこう見る

宮川さんのPodcastingが好きでよく聞くのですが、そこには参考URLが掲載されています。話題に挙がったサービス、ソフトウェアを調べるのには便利なのですが、それがどう便利であるかと言った点は全体を通して聞かないと分からないのが難点です。TimeJumpを解決できそうです。

動画や音声のサービスはテキストに比べると数倍冗長的でユーザにとって束縛の強いものになってしまいます。それだけにピンポイントにリンクできたり、頭出しができるTimeJumpは相当役立つのではないでしょうか。

TimeJump – Deep linking for Podcasts

davatron5000/TimeJump